Why portfolio and facilities operations need a different ERP strategy
Real estate operations are structurally complex because they combine recurring service delivery, long-lived assets, contract-heavy processes, and decentralized execution. A portfolio may include office, retail, industrial, mixed-use, hospitality, or residential assets, each with different maintenance models, compliance obligations, vendor ecosystems, and tenant expectations. Traditional property systems often handle a narrow slice of this landscape, such as lease administration or accounting, but fail to orchestrate the end-to-end operating model.
This is why ERP modernization in real estate should be framed as business process management, not just software consolidation. Executives need a platform strategy that supports multi-company management, site-level operational control, shared services, and enterprise scalability. In practice, this means integrating finance, procurement, inventory management for maintenance materials, project management for fit-outs and capital works, CRM for prospect and tenant interactions, and maintenance workflows for preventive and reactive service delivery. The objective is a portfolio command model where data moves with the process instead of being re-entered by each department.
Industry challenges that keep legacy environments expensive
Most real estate organizations do not struggle because they lack software. They struggle because their systems mirror organizational silos. Facilities teams manage work orders in one tool, procurement runs vendor approvals in email, finance closes the month in a separate system, and asset managers build portfolio views manually in spreadsheets. The result is delayed reporting, inconsistent master data, weak audit trails, and limited confidence in operational KPIs.
- Property and facilities data are fragmented across accounting platforms, CAFM tools, spreadsheets, contractor portals, and document repositories.
- Preventive maintenance plans are disconnected from procurement, inventory, and budget controls, causing service delays and cost leakage.
- Multi-entity structures create intercompany complexity for shared services, chargebacks, approvals, and reporting.
- Capital projects, tenant improvements, and repair programs are often tracked outside the core operating system, reducing forecast accuracy.
- Compliance evidence, contracts, certificates, and site documentation are difficult to retrieve during audits or incident reviews.
- Executive reporting depends on manual consolidation, which limits timely decisions during occupancy shifts, cost inflation, or service disruptions.
Where operational bottlenecks usually appear first
In most portfolios, the first visible bottlenecks emerge at the handoff points between teams. A facilities manager raises a work request, but vendor onboarding is incomplete. A contractor completes a job, but supporting documents are missing for invoice approval. A site team orders parts urgently, but inventory records are inaccurate. Finance receives costs late, so accruals are estimated rather than evidenced. These are not isolated process failures. They are symptoms of an operating model without shared workflow logic.
A realistic example is a regional commercial portfolio managing HVAC maintenance across dozens of sites. Without integrated maintenance, purchase, inventory, and accounting workflows, service teams cannot reliably distinguish between planned maintenance, emergency repairs, and capitalizable replacements. That affects vendor dispatch, stock availability, budget coding, and asset lifecycle decisions. Modernization should therefore prioritize process continuity from request to approval, execution, cost capture, and performance review.
| Operational area | Legacy bottleneck | Business impact | Modernization priority |
|---|---|---|---|
| Maintenance | Reactive work orders managed outside finance and procurement | Higher downtime, poor cost visibility, weak SLA control | Integrate Maintenance, Purchase, Inventory, Accounting |
| Procurement | Vendor approvals and contract checks handled by email | Slow sourcing, compliance risk, inconsistent pricing | Standardize approval workflows and supplier records |
| Portfolio reporting | Manual consolidation across entities and assets | Delayed decisions, low trust in KPIs | Create shared data model and BI-ready reporting |
| Capital projects | Fit-outs and refurbishments tracked separately from operations | Budget overruns, poor handover to facilities | Connect Project, Documents, approvals, and cost controls |
| Tenant service | Requests and communications split across channels | Lower satisfaction, missed commitments | Unify CRM, Helpdesk or Field Service where relevant |
What a modern real estate ERP operating model should include
The target state is not a monolithic system that forces every process into one template. It is a governed platform model that standardizes core data, controls, and workflows while allowing operational variation by asset class or geography. For real estate, the most valuable design principle is to align the ERP around operational events: tenant onboarding, service requests, preventive maintenance cycles, vendor engagement, project milestones, invoice approvals, and portfolio reviews.
Odoo applications can support this model when mapped carefully to business needs. CRM can structure prospect, tenant, and occupier interactions. Project can govern fit-outs, mobilizations, and capital works. Maintenance can manage preventive schedules, asset histories, and work orders. Purchase and Inventory can control materials, contractor spend, and site stock. Accounting can support entity-level controls and management reporting. Documents and Knowledge can centralize contracts, compliance records, SOPs, and site documentation. Helpdesk or Field Service may be relevant for service-intensive environments where tenant requests and technician dispatch need tighter orchestration.
Decision framework for application scope
Executives should avoid over-scoping the first phase. The right question is not which modules are available, but which workflows create the highest operational drag or financial risk today. If maintenance cost leakage is the issue, start with Maintenance, Purchase, Inventory, Documents, and Accounting integration. If tenant service quality is the issue, prioritize CRM, Helpdesk, Project, and knowledge workflows. If portfolio reporting is the issue, focus on master data governance, entity structures, approval logic, and business intelligence readiness before expanding functional scope.
A phased digital transformation roadmap for portfolio operators
A practical roadmap begins with operating model clarity, not configuration workshops. Leadership should define which decisions the future ERP must improve: capital allocation, service performance, vendor control, occupancy economics, compliance readiness, or month-end speed. From there, the program should establish process ownership, data standards, integration boundaries, and governance rules before implementation begins.
- Phase 1: Define portfolio-wide process standards, entity structures, approval policies, asset hierarchies, and KPI definitions.
- Phase 2: Modernize high-friction workflows such as maintenance, procurement, invoice control, and document governance.
- Phase 3: Connect project management, tenant lifecycle processes, and portfolio reporting for broader operational visibility.
- Phase 4: Introduce AI-assisted operations, predictive planning, and advanced business intelligence once data quality is stable.
This phased approach reduces transformation risk and creates measurable value early. It also helps ERP partners, system integrators, and enterprise architects sequence integrations more intelligently. KPIs, ROI logic, and the metrics that matter to executives
ERP modernization in real estate should be justified through operating economics, control improvement, and decision speed. The strongest business case usually combines direct efficiency gains with reduced risk exposure and better asset performance. Leaders should avoid generic ROI narratives and instead define measurable outcomes tied to their portfolio model.
| KPI category | Example metrics | Why it matters |
|---|---|---|
| Facilities performance | Preventive vs reactive maintenance ratio, work order cycle time, first-time completion rate | Indicates service maturity, downtime exposure, and labor efficiency |
| Financial control | Invoice approval cycle time, accrual accuracy, budget variance, spend under contract | Improves cash control, forecasting confidence, and audit readiness |
| Portfolio operations | Site compliance completion, vendor SLA attainment, asset downtime, project milestone adherence | Links operational execution to tenant experience and asset value protection |
| Data and governance | Master data completeness, exception rates, reporting latency, user adoption by workflow | Shows whether modernization is producing trusted decisions |
A realistic ROI model may include fewer emergency repairs due to better preventive maintenance, lower maverick spend through procurement controls, faster month-end close from cleaner cost capture, and reduced administrative effort in document retrieval and approvals. It may also include less visible but strategically important gains such as stronger compliance evidence, better capital planning, and improved operational resilience during vendor disruption or site incidents.
Common implementation mistakes and how to avoid them
The most common mistake is treating ERP modernization as a software migration rather than an operating model redesign. When teams replicate legacy workflows inside a new platform, they preserve the same delays, exceptions, and data quality issues. Another frequent error is underestimating master data governance. If asset registers, supplier records, chart of accounts structures, and site hierarchies are inconsistent, automation will scale confusion rather than control.
A third mistake is ignoring change management for site teams, facilities managers, and finance approvers. Real estate operations are highly exception-driven, so users need clear decision rights, escalation paths, and training tied to real scenarios. Finally, many programs fail by over-customizing too early. Studio and workflow extensions can be useful, but only after the organization has validated standard process patterns and integration requirements.
Governance, compliance, and risk mitigation in real estate environments
Governance in real estate ERP is not limited to financial approval matrices. It includes document retention, contractor controls, segregation of duties, site-level compliance evidence, data access by entity and geography, and traceability across maintenance, procurement, and project workflows. Organizations operating across jurisdictions must also account for local reporting, labor, tax, and property-related compliance obligations within their process design.
Risk mitigation should focus on operational continuity as much as cybersecurity. That means designing fallback procedures for work order intake, vendor communication, and invoice processing if systems are unavailable. It also means enforcing identity and access management, role-based permissions, audit logs, backup testing, and monitoring. For portfolios with outsourced service delivery, governance should extend to contractor onboarding, document validation, and performance review so that third-party execution does not become a blind spot.
Future trends shaping the next generation of real estate ERP
The next phase of modernization will be defined by AI-assisted operations, deeper workflow automation, and more contextual analytics. In real estate, the most practical AI use cases are not speculative. They include prioritizing maintenance backlogs, identifying invoice anomalies, summarizing vendor performance issues, surfacing contract obligations, and improving service desk triage. These capabilities depend on clean operational data and governed processes, which is why foundational ERP modernization still matters.
Another important trend is the convergence of portfolio, facilities, and project data into a common decision layer. As organizations seek better capital planning and asset lifecycle management, they will need ERP environments that can connect maintenance history, project spend, procurement trends, and financial outcomes. The firms that benefit most will be those that treat ERP as a strategic operating platform supported by disciplined integration, business intelligence, and managed cloud operations rather than as a back-office record system.
